How many calories are in a bite size mini Butterfinger? ›

Mini Butterfinger (1 miniature/bite size) contains 5.1g total carbs, 5g net carbs, 1.3g fat, 0.4g protein, and 32 calories.

Is Butterfinger ice cream discontinued? ›

Ice Cream Bar: A product with an ice cream filling, the Butterfinger Ice Cream Bar, was introduced in 1991 and continues to be sold in individual bags to this day. Another product similar to that of Butterfinger Ice Cream Bars, but shaped in a nugget form, also was developed in 1992 and is now discontinued.

When were Butterfingers discontinued? ›

As for when Butterfinger BB's were officially yanked from store shelves, it seems that they were discontinued by 2006. The move raised the ire of Butterfinger fans, who were equally flummoxed when the brand decided to change its recipe in 2019.

Why don t they make Butterfinger BBS anymore? ›

In reply to a post on X, formerly known as Twitter, the candy manufacturer stated, "Sadly, Butterfinger BB's were discontinued due to low sales." Despite the clear-cut answer, others have their own opinions on the discontinuation, such as the possibility that the snacks pose a choking hazard.

Did they stop making creme eggs? ›

Creme Eggs are available annually between New Year's Day and Easter Sunday. In the UK in the 1980s, Cadbury made Creme Eggs available year-round but sales dropped and they returned to seasonal availability. In 2018, white chocolate versions of the Creme Eggs were made available.
